About Budock Water

Budock Water is a coastal settlement located in the county of Cornwall, in the south-west of England. Situated within the TR11 postcode area, it lies along the eastern shore of the Helford River, offering views across the water to the surrounding countryside. The area is known for its maritime heritage and is popular with boating enthusiasts, with several small harbours and marinas providing access to the sea. The village has a relaxed atmosphere, with a mix of residential properties and holiday homes. It is close to the larger village of Budock, which offers local amenities and a community feel. The surrounding landscape features wooded hills and coastal paths, making it a pleasant spot for walking and enjoying the natural environment.
